dotty definitions

WordNet (r) 3.0 (2005)

adj
1: informal or slang terms for mentally irregular; "it used to drive my husband balmy" [syn: balmy, barmy, bats, batty, bonkers, buggy, cracked, crackers, daft, dotty, fruity, haywire, kooky, kookie, loco, loony, loopy, nuts, nutty, round the bend, around the bend, wacky, whacky]
2: intensely enthusiastic about or preoccupied with; "crazy about cars and racing"; "he is potty about her" [syn: crazy, wild, dotty, gaga]

Merriam Webster's

I. adjective (dottier; -est) Etymology: alteration of Scots dottle fool, from Middle English dotel, from doten Date: 15th century 1. a. mentally unbalanced ; crazy b. amiably eccentric <a dotty old relative> 2. being obsessed or infatuated <dotty fans> 3. amusingly absurd ; ridiculous <dotty traditions> • dottily adverbdottiness noun II. adjective Date: 1812 composed of or marked by dots

Oxford Reference Dictionary

adj. (dottier, dottiest) colloq. 1 feeble-minded, silly. 2 eccentric. 3 absurd. 4 (foll. by about, on) infatuated with; obsessed by. Derivatives: dottily adv. dottiness n. Etymology: earlier = unsteady: f. DOT(1) + -Y(1)

Webster's 1913 Dictionary

Dotty Dot"ty, a. [From 2d Dot.] 1. Composed of, or characterized by, dots. 2. [Perh. a different word; cf. Totty.] Unsteady in gait; hence, feeble; half-witted. [Eng.]

Collin's Cobuild Dictionary

(dottier, dottiest) If you say that someone is dotty, you mean that they are slightly mad or likely to do strange things. (mainly BRIT INFORMAL) She was obviously going a bit dotty. ADJ
